对比观察不同核处理手法在不同硬度晶体核乳化中的应用。方法 :198例 ( 2 2 2眼 )白内障采用连续环形撕囊或开罐式截囊 ,分别采用蚀刻分割法和劈裂法 ,在囊袋内或虹膜瞳孔平面完成超声乳化。记录两种方式的有效超声时间。结果 :在 级~ 级硬度核中劈裂法的平均有效超声时间明显少于蚀刻分割法的平均有效时间 ( P<0 .0 0 1或 0 .0 5 ,t检验 ) ,且在硬度较高的晶体核较为明显。结论 :应用劈裂法可以缩短超声时间 ,提高手术效率和治疗效果
